文案桥梁网—你的文案搜索专家

文案桥梁网—你的文案搜索专家

如何快捷的在excel中随机生成100甚至更多的词语

59

在Excel中快速生成100个或更多随机词语,可通过以下方法实现:

一、使用`RANDBETWEEN`函数生成单词语

生成单词语示例

使用`=RANDBETWEEN(1,100)`生成1到100之间的整数,结合`CHOOSE`函数可对应到预定义的词语表。例如:

```excel

=CHOOSE(RANDBETWEEN(1,100), "老虎", "杠子", "鸡")

```

这样可确保每个词语被等概率选中。

扩展到多词组

若需生成多词组(如"老虎/杠子/鸡"),可修改公式:

```excel

=CHOOSE(RANDBETWEEN(1,3), "老虎", "杠子", "鸡")

```

通过调整`RANDBETWEEN`的范围,可灵活控制词组数量。

二、优化公式提升效率

减少函数嵌套:

`CHOOSE`函数比多个`IF`语句更简洁高效。

批量生成:输入公式后,通过拖拽填充柄可快速生成整行或整列数据。

三、注意事项

字符编码限制:

`CHOOSE`函数最多支持256个预定义值,若词语表超过此数量需采用其他方法。

数据验证:

生成结果可能包含非预期字符,建议生成后检查并清理数据。

四、补充说明

随机小数转文字:若需生成随机小数并转换为文字(如金额格式),可结合`TEXT`函数,例如:

```excel

=TEXT(ROUND(RAND()*100,2),"¥,0.00")

```

动态扩展:通过调整公式参数(如`RAND()*范围值`),可轻松适应不同数据量需求。

通过以上方法,可高效生成大量随机词语,并根据实际需求进行扩展和优化。